edge; deletion reverses that order. Foundation does not create the child DNS
zone or its delegation: it creates only the project, runner, and exact
conditional permission to change that organization's NS record in the
existing parent zone. The edge state is the sole Terraform owner of the child
zone, parent delegation, child records, and child-zone controller IAM.

Deletion is staged and terminal. Edge provider resources are removed first.
The first destructive edge apply removes child records and then the parent NS
while retaining the empty child zone and controller IAM. The control plane
persists the successful removal time and highest published delegation TTL,
waits that full interval, and then requires the exact NS record to be absent
from both a trusted recursive view and every current parent authoritative
server. Only a later edge apply may delete the empty `force_destroy = false`
zone and controller IAM. Vault, organization, and foundation state remain
blocked until that final edge apply succeeds; foundation's parent-zone IAM is
removed last.

Externally billed project capacity must likewise be removed idempotently before
the local tombstone commits, and a project is not marked decommissioned until
its final infrastructure apply succeeds. An organization delete does not
silently cascade through projects; every retained project must already be
terminal and decommissioned, with billing in a terminal `canceled` or
`incomplete_expired` state (or no subscription). A site does not receive an
independent Terraform state, and one state must not manage a resource owned by
another root. Downstream operators must not bypass a managed phase by manually
deleting the delegation, child zone, or foundation IAM.
